Lawn Care Tips

Caring For Your New Lawn

For the first couple of weeks, Floratam needs to be watered daily. After that, you can cut it back to 2 or 3 times a week. Here are some fertilizing tips to maintain a healthy lawn.
  • Be careful not to over-fertilize your yard as it can create problems.
  • Fertilize your lawn during the Spring and Fall to encourage growth before the Summer and to help the roots as the weather cools.
  • Buy local sod as local sod companies develop sod that are suited for local climate and soil.

Common Weeds Concerns

When it comes to weeds, don't wait until they completely take over your lawn. Proper care can help control the weeds and save you lots of money. Here are some tips about weeds.
  • Weeds do not need much care to grow. Simply watering your lawn is not enough to keep them under control.
  • Keep your grass healthy and strong by regularly watering and fertilizing. Use environmentally friendly pesticides and follow the instructions carefully.
  • Monitor your grass and identify problems quickly. Weeds thrive on weak and unhealthy grass.
